"mortified" in Chinese (Traditional)
羞愧難當尷尬極了
Definition
因為發生了某事而感到極度羞愧或尷尬。
Usage Notes (Chinese (Traditional))
比「尷尬」更強烈,常用於形容極度羞辱或在公開場合丟臉。常配合“by”或“when”等短語使用,例如“mortified by his mistake”。
Examples
I was mortified when I forgot my lines on stage.
我在舞臺上忘詞時感到**羞愧難當**。
She felt mortified by her mistake at work.
她因工作上的錯誤感到**尷尬極了**。
He was mortified when his phone rang during the exam.
考試時他手機響了,感到**羞愧難當**。
I was absolutely mortified when my parents showed up at the party.
我爸媽出現在派對時,我簡直**尷尬極了**。
